12 DOF · 45° slopes · 8kg payload · OmniOS AI brain · obstacle avoidance. 4× cheaper than Boston Dynamics Spot — assembled in Kathmandu.
| Specification | Detail |
|---|---|
| Locomotion | 12 DOF quadruped; dynamic stability at 45° slopes; stair climbing |
| Weight / Payload | 18 kg body; 8 kg payload; hot-swap battery in <45 seconds |
| Speed | 3.5 m/s walk; 5.2 m/s trot; remote and autonomous modes |
| AI Brain | OmniOS — obstacle avoidance, terrain mapping, face recognition (IrisVision) |
| Sensors | LiDAR 360° · Stereo camera · IMU · Thermal · Gas sensor (modular) |
| Battery | 48V LiPo; 90 min; hot-swap <45 sec |
| Unit Price | NPR 27L (USD 18,000) — vs. Boston Dynamics Spot: USD 74,500 (4.1× cheaper) |
| Manufacturing Cost | NPR 6.3L (USD 4,200) — 77% gross margin at scale |
| Applications | Search & rescue · Mine inspection · Factory patrol · Military ISR · Security |
IMPORTANT: The RoboDog Cargo Buggy is NOT a robotic vehicle. It is a heavy-duty, human-driven cargo buggy purpose-built to carry loads of up to 150 kg. For mountain trails, farm tracks, and remote terrain where motorised vehicles cannot go.
| Specification | Detail |
|---|---|
| Drive Type | Human-driven — operator walks or rides; lever-assisted tipping; no motor |
| Load Capacity | 150 kg rated payload (certified load test); 200 kg chassis capacity |
| Frame | 6061 aluminium alloy + high-tensile steel reinforcement; powder coated |
| Wheels | 16-inch all-terrain pneumatic tyres; puncture-resistant; 4-wheel option |
| Terrain | Mountain trails · farm tracks · construction sites · slope up to 30° |
| Unit Price | NPR 5.25L (USD 3,500) — 71% gross margin; materials sourced in Nepal + India |
| Year 1 Target | 200 units: 120 domestic (agri + construction) · 80 export (India + Gulf) |
| Social Impact | Replaces animal-drawn carts; reduces porter loads; empowers women farmers |

Nepal's first bipedal humanoid. 172cm · 42kg · 32 DOF · 5-finger hands. Voice in Nepali, Hindi, English, Arabic. 8 paid pilot deployments Year 1.
| Specification | Detail |
|---|---|
| Height / Weight | 172 cm / 42 kg; rated for indoor commercial environments |
| Degrees of Freedom | 32 DOF — arms (7+7), legs (6+6), torso (4), head (2) |
| Hands | 5-finger dexterous; 3 kg per arm; pinch force 15N |
| AI & Voice | OmniOS + OmniLLM; voice commands in Nepali, Hindi, English, Arabic |
| Unit Price | NPR 48L (USD 32,000) — vs. Unitree H1: USD 90,000 |
| Year 1 Pilots | 8 deployments: Hotels (2), Hospitals (3), Factories (3) |
| Year 2 Commercial | 50 units — NPR 24 Crore (USD 1.6M) revenue contribution |
